What is CFP Franc (XPF)

The CFP Franc (French: Franc Pacifique) is a currency used in several Pacific territories that are associated with France, including French Polynesia, New Caledonia, and Wallis and Futuna. The currency is abbreviated as XPF and is subdivided into 100 centimes. The CFP Franc is tied to the Euro, with a fixed exchange rate, making it relatively stable compared to other currencies.

Originally established in 1945, the CFP Franc was introduced to facilitate trade and provide economic stability in these territories. Its value is directly linked to the Euro, with an exchange rate of approximately 1 XPF = 0.0084 EUR. This connection to the Euro influences its value and stability, making it a reliable currency for transactions within the Pacific region.

The CFP Franc is often used for transactions in local markets and international trade, impacting the economies of the territories that utilize it. Tourists in these regions will likely encounter the CFP Franc frequently, as it is the primary medium of exchange.

What is Zambian Kwacha (ZMK)

The Zambian Kwacha, represented by the symbol ZK and abbreviated as ZMK, is the currency of Zambia. It was first introduced in 1968, replacing the Zambian Pound at a rate of 1 Kwacha to 2 Pounds. The Zambian Kwacha is subdivided into 100 tambala, although tambala coins are rarely used in everyday transactions.

The Kwacha's value has seen fluctuations due to various economic factors, including inflation and changes in the global market. Currently, the Zambian Kwacha is subject to exchange rates that are influenced by Zambia's economic performance, trade balance, and foreign investments.
